Meanwhile, the Amnesty Boss used the medium to urge the Agitators and stakeholders to join hands with him, to increase the impact of the programme.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Recall that a five-day stakeholders&#8217; meeting was convened in Warri, Delta State, by the Office of the Administrator of the Presidential Amnesty Programme, Dr. Otuaro. The meeting commenced on Friday, June 21, 2024, and would last until Tuesday, June 25, 2024.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Excited by the Administrator&#8217;s initiative, the Stakeholders requested that these kind of engagements and meetings should continue, in order to discuss and address issues bothering on the success of the Programme at every point.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Furthermore, the following issues were raised by the Ex-Agitators which were; medical program to support stakeholders&#8217; health, particularly those who had been injured during the struggle, an evaluation of beneficiary stipends that should be increased from N65,000k, the inclusion of stakeholders&#8217; children in the program for training and empowerment, and keeping stakeholders updated on PAP developments, and that the federal government view the PAP as a security program and pay the Amnesty Office as soon as possible to avoid delays in the implementation of its programs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Additionally, the Stakeholders and the Ex-Agitators also requested that the intellectual arm of the struggle, or advocacy, should be acknowledged and those engaged in it should be empowered and trained. And that the procedures for enrolling beneficiaries in the amnesty program should be reevaluated in order to remove any obstacles, and the PAP Administrator must listen intently to stakeholders, and the stakeholders must in turn refrain from harming the Administrator&#8217;s reputation out of self-interest.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Consequently, Dr. Otuaro in his remark emphasized on the significance of inclusive development, the necessity of sending more recipients for overseas scholarships and skill development, the necessity of extensive training programs, and the empowerment of those who had previously received training.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The Amnesty Boss also stated how important it is to fix systemic flaws in order to guarantee that the program&#8217;s advantages are dispersed fairly and are available to all qualified participants.<br \/>He also called for unity among stakeholders, urging them to refrain from dividing actions, and to communicate any genuine concerns to him. Further assuring them that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u is committed to the development of the Niger Delta region and is determined to take the program to a new height.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Conclusively, the PAP Administrator asserted that as a people, we can make a strong case to His Excellency, President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, only if we can maintain this calm displayed by stakeholders, and come up with innovative ideas. He also revealed his intention to interact with important stakeholders who are not currently included in the amnesty program, in order to include them and give them a sense of belonging.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>By Freeborn Abraye Former Niger Delta Agitators and Stakeholders have applauded Chief Dr. Dennis Otuaro,&#8230;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":2,"featured_media":2562,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"jetpack_post_was_ever_published":false,"_jetpack_newsletter_access":"","_jetpack_dont_email_post_to_subs":false,"_jetpack_newsletter_tier_id":0,"_jetpack_memberships_contains_paywalled_content":false,"_jetpack_memberships_contains_paid_content":false,"footnotes":"","jetpack_publicize_message":"","jetpack_publicize_feature_enabled":true,"jetpack_social_post_already_shared":true,"jetpack_social_options":{"image_generator_settings":{"template":"highway","default_image_id":0,"font":"","enabled":false},"version":2}},"categories":[398,14],"tags":[536,535,534],"class_list":["post-2559","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","category-community","category-opinion","tag-as-the-administrator-calls-for-cooperation","tag-stakeholders-applaud-otuaro","tag-stakeholders-meeting-niger-delta-ex-agitators"],"jetpack_publicize_connections":[],"jetpack_featured_media_url":"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/coastaltimes.com.ng\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/06\/img_3516-2-1.jpg?fit=2000%2C1506&ssl=1","jetpack_sharing_enabled":true,"jetpack_likes_enabled":true,"jetpack-related-posts":[{"id":4592,"url":"https:\/\/coastaltimes.com.ng\/index.php\/2025\/08\/07\/amnesty-edo-based-ex-niger-delta-agitators-commends-dr-otuaro-on-successful-leadership-training-urges-other-ex-agitators-stakeholders-to-support-him\/","url_meta":{"origin":2559,"position":0},"title":"AMNESTY: Edo Based Ex-Niger Delta Agitators Commends Dr. Otuaro On Successful Leadership Training, Urges Other Ex-Agitators, Stakeholders To Support Him","author":"Freeborn Abraye","date":"August 7, 2025","format":false,"excerpt":"By Freeborn Abraye BENIN CITY \u2013 THE leadership of Niger Delta Ex-militant Forum Edo State chapter on Wednesday commended the Administrator of the Presidential Amnesty Programme (PAP), Chief Dennis Otuaro on his sustaining of the amnesty programme and continuous training of former militants.
